The default registry provides 190+ self-hosted application templates. + +**Search:** Type in the search bar to filter templates by name or description in real-time. + +**Categories:** Click any category pill to narrow the list: +`Automation` · `Books` · `Development` · `Documentation` · `Downloaders` · `Media` · `Monitoring` · `Networking` · `Other` · `Product` + +Each template card shows: +- Application logo +- Name and short description +- Category tags +- Links to the GitHub repo and documentation (where available) + +## Deploying a template + +Click any template card to open the **deployment sheet** on the right side of the screen. Fill in the fields and click **Deploy**. + +### Stack name + +Pre-filled with the template name in lowercase. You can change it — the same [naming rules](/features/stack-management#creating-a-stack) apply (lowercase, hyphens, no spaces). + +### Environment variables + +Each template declares the variables it needs. Sencho pre-fills sensible defaults where available (e.g. `PUID=1000`, `PGID=1000`, `TZ` from your browser locale). + +Edit any value before deploying. You can also click **Custom Env** to add arbitrary key-value pairs not defined by the template. + +### Volumes + +For each container mount point, enter the **host path** where that data should be stored. Suggested defaults (e.g. `./config`, `./data`) are shown as placeholders. + + + Relative paths like `./config` are resolved relative to the stack directory inside your `COMPOSE_DIR`. Absolute paths map directly to the host filesystem. + + +### Ports + +For each exposed port, edit the **host port** (left side). The container port (right side) is fixed by the template and cannot be changed here — edit the compose file after deployment if needed. + +### What happens on Deploy + +1. Sencho creates a new stack directory in `COMPOSE_DIR` +2. Writes the generated `compose.yaml` and `.env` file +3. Runs `docker compose up -d` +4. On success: switches you to the Editor view for that stack +5. On failure: rolls back by running `docker compose down` and deleting the stack directory + +A toast notification confirms success or shows the error message. + +## Custom template registry + +By default Sencho uses the LinuxServer.io template registry. To use your own: + +1. Open **Settings → App Store** +2. Enter your registry URL (must serve a JSON array of template objects in Portainer v2 format) +3. Click **Save** + +To force a refresh of the cached templates, click **Refresh Cache** in the same settings panel. diff --git a/docs/features/dashboard.mdx b/docs/features/dashboard.mdx new file mode 100644 index 00000000..2869e351 --- /dev/null +++ b/docs/features/dashboard.mdx @@ -0,0 +1,60 @@ +--- +title: Dashboard +description: Real-time system stats, historical metrics, and a quick-start converter for your host machine. +--- + +The **Home** tab is the first thing you see after logging in. It shows a live snapshot of your host's health alongside container activity across all stacks. + + + Sencho dashboard showing container stats, system stats, and historical charts + + +## Container stats + +The top row summarises container state at a glance: + +| Card | What it shows | +|------|---------------| +| **Active Containers** | Running containers — broken down as `N managed · N external` | +| **Exited Containers** | Stopped or crashed containers | +| **Docker Network** | Current inbound/outbound network throughput across all containers | + +**Managed** means the container belongs to a stack in your `COMPOSE_DIR`. **External** means it exists on the Docker host but was started outside Sencho (e.g. by another Compose project or `docker run`). + +## System stats + +The second row shows host-level resource usage, polled every few seconds: + +| Card | What it shows | +|------|---------------| +| **Host CPU** | Current CPU usage percentage and core count | +| **Host RAM** | Used / total memory in GB and percentage | +| **Host Disk** | Used / total disk space for the primary mount point | + +When any value exceeds configured thresholds (set in **Settings → System Limits**), the card changes colour as a visual warning. + +## Historical metrics charts + +Two area charts display time-series data sampled at one-minute intervals, retained for up to 24 hours (configurable in **Settings → Developer**): + +- **Normalized CPU Usage** — total CPU percentage across all managed containers, normalised over all host cores +- **Normalized RAM Usage** — total memory allocated by managed containers, in GB + +The x-axis shows time labels. Hover over a data point to see the exact value at that moment. + + + Charts only show data from the moment Sencho started. If you just installed Sencho, they will be mostly empty until metrics accumulate. + + +## Convert `docker run` to Compose + +The bottom panel provides a quick converter: paste any `docker run` command and Sencho transforms it into a valid `docker-compose.yaml` snippet. + +```bash +# Example input +docker run -d --name myapp -p 8080:80 -e TZ=UTC -v /data:/app/data nginx:latest +``` + +Click **Convert** and the output YAML appears ready to copy. You can then create a new stack and paste it into the editor. + +This is useful when migrating existing containers to managed Compose stacks without having to write YAML by hand. diff --git a/docs/features/global-observability.mdx b/docs/features/global-observability.mdx new file mode 100644 index 00000000..4e396666 --- /dev/null +++ b/docs/features/global-observability.mdx @@ -0,0 +1,58 @@ +--- +title: Global Observability +description: A unified, searchable log stream from every container across all your stacks. +--- + +The **Logs** tab aggregates output from all running containers into a single scrollable view. Instead of tailing logs one container at a time, you see everything in one place — with filtering to focus on what matters. + + + Global Observability view showing real-time log lines from multiple containers + + +## Log format + +Each line shows: + +- **Timestamp** — when the log line was emitted +- **Stack name** — the Compose stack the container belongs to (colour-coded) +- **Container name** — the specific container +- **Level** — `INFO`, `WARN`, or `ERROR` (where detectable) +- **Message** — the raw log output + +## Streaming modes + +Sencho supports two modes for fetching logs, switchable via the **Developer mode** toggle: + +| Mode | How it works | Best for | +|------|-------------|----------| +| **Standard** (default) | Polls all containers every N seconds (configurable in Settings → Developer) | General use; lower overhead | +| **Developer mode** | Server-Sent Events stream; logs arrive as they are emitted | Debugging; watching a specific event in real-time | + +The default polling interval is 5 seconds. You can change it to 1, 3, 5, or 10 seconds in **Settings → Developer → Global Logs Refresh Rate**. + +## Filtering logs + +Use the controls above the log panel to narrow what you see: + +| Control | What it does | +|---------|-------------| +| **Stack filter** | Multi-select dropdown — show only logs from chosen stacks | +| **Stream** | `ALL` / `STDOUT` / `STDERR` — filter by output stream | +| **Search** | Full-text filter on the message field (case-insensitive) | + +Filters combine — you can show only `STDERR` from a specific stack while searching for a keyword. + +## Controls + +| Button | What it does | +|--------|-------------| +| **Clear** | Clears the current log buffer in the UI (does not delete logs from Docker) | +| **Auto-scroll** toggle | When enabled, the view scrolls to the bottom as new lines arrive | + +## Capacity limits + +To avoid browser memory issues, the log view keeps a maximum of **2,000 entries** in memory at a time. Older entries are dropped as new ones arrive. For deeper investigation, use the [per-container log viewer](/features/editor#log-viewer) in the Editor tab, or `docker compose logs` directly from the [Host Console](/features/host-console). + + + Log retention on the backend is controlled by **Settings → Developer → Log Retention Days** (default: 30 days). This affects historical logs stored in Sencho's database, not the live stream. + diff --git a/docs/features/host-console.mdx b/docs/features/host-console.mdx new file mode 100644 index 00000000..6108b2e3 --- /dev/null +++ b/docs/features/host-console.mdx @@ -0,0 +1,54 @@ +--- +title: Host Console +description: An interactive terminal on your host OS, directly in the browser — no SSH required. +--- + +The **Console** tab opens a full interactive terminal session on the machine running Sencho. It behaves exactly like an SSH session, but without needing an SSH server, client, or key management. + + + Host Console showing a PowerShell prompt inside the Sencho container working directory + + +## What it is + +The host console spawns a real PTY (pseudo-terminal) process on the Sencho host using `node-pty`. Your keystrokes are sent over a WebSocket and the terminal output is streamed back in real-time. The terminal emulator is [xterm.js](https://xtermjs.org/), the same engine used by VS Code's built-in terminal. + +Features: +- Full colour and cursor support +- Tab completion (via the host shell) +- Scrollback buffer (10,000 lines) +- Automatic terminal resizing when you resize the browser window +- Copy and paste + +## Opening the console + +Click **Console** in the top navigation bar. The session starts immediately in the stack's working directory if a stack is selected, otherwise in the `COMPOSE_DIR` root. + +The header shows the connection status (**Connected** in green) and which node the console is attached to. + +Click **Close Console** to end the session and terminate the shell process on the host. + +## Shell type + +The shell depends on the host OS: +- **Linux/macOS hosts:** `bash` or `sh` +- **Windows hosts (Docker Desktop):** PowerShell (as shown in the screenshot — the console opens inside the Sencho container's Windows environment) + +## Security model + +The host console has a stricter authentication requirement than other features: + +- Requires a valid **browser session** (httpOnly cookie). Node-proxy tokens used for multi-node communication are explicitly blocked. +- Each session is issued a short-lived **console token** (60-second TTL) before the WebSocket is established. +- Because the console gives full shell access to the host, you should secure your Sencho instance with HTTPS and a strong password if it is exposed to a network. + + + The host console provides unrestricted shell access to the machine running Sencho. Do not expose Sencho on a public network without HTTPS and strong authentication. + + +## Common uses + +- Inspecting files in your `COMPOSE_DIR` without leaving the browser +- Running `docker compose logs --follow` or `docker ps` directly +- Editing files with `nano` or `vim` for quick fixes +- Running maintenance scripts or one-off commands on the host diff --git a/docs/features/resources.mdx b/docs/features/resources.mdx new file mode 100644 index 00000000..96c305c0 --- /dev/null +++ b/docs/features/resources.mdx @@ -0,0 +1,75 @@ +--- +title: Resources Hub +description: Browse, filter, and clean up Docker images, volumes, networks, and unmanaged containers. +--- + +The **Resources** tab gives you a full view of everything Docker is storing on your host, broken down by type and ownership. + + + Resources Hub showing disk footprint, quick clean panel, and images table + + +## Docker disk footprint + +The stacked bar at the top visualises how your Docker disk usage is distributed: + +| Segment | Meaning | +|---------|---------| +| **Sencho Managed** (green) | Images used by stacks in your `COMPOSE_DIR` | +| **External Projects** (orange) | Images used by Docker projects outside Sencho | +| **Reclaimable** (gray) | Unused images and dangling layers safe to delete | + +Click any segment to automatically filter the tabs below to that category. + +## Quick Clean panel + +Four prune buttons let you reclaim disk space immediately. By default they operate on **Sencho-managed resources only** — they will not touch external Docker projects. + +| Button | What it removes | +|--------|----------------| +| **Prune Unused Images** | Images with no running containers in Sencho stacks | +| **Prune Unused Volumes** | Volumes not attached to any Sencho container | +| **Prune Dead Networks** | Networks not connected to any Sencho container | +| **Purge Unmanaged Containers** | Containers Sencho doesn't recognise (started outside it) | + +Each button has a **⋮ More options** menu that lets you target **all Docker resources** instead of Sencho-only. Use this carefully — it can affect other Compose projects running on the same host. + +A confirmation dialog appears before any destructive operation, showing a summary of what will be removed. + +## Resource tabs + +### Images + +Lists all Docker images on the host with their ID, repository tag, size, and status. + +**Filter buttons:** `All` · `Managed` · `External` + +**Status badges:** +- `In Use` + stack name — image is actively used by a running container +- `Unused` — image has no running containers; safe to delete + +Click the trash icon on any row to delete an individual image. Sencho will warn you if the image is in use. + +### Volumes + +Lists all Docker volumes. Columns: name, driver, mount point, size, and managed status. + +**Filter buttons:** `All` · `Managed` · `External` + + + Deleting a volume is permanent. Any data stored in it will be lost. Always back up important volume data before pruning. + + +### Networks + +Lists all Docker networks. Columns: name, driver, scope (`local`, `global`, `swarm`), and managed status. + +**Filter buttons:** `All` · `Managed` · `External` · `System` + +System networks (like `bridge`, `host`, `none`) are shown but cannot be deleted. + +### Unmanaged + +Lists containers running on the host that are not part of any Sencho-managed stack. This includes containers started with `docker run`, or Compose projects outside your `COMPOSE_DIR`. + +This view is useful for identifying orphaned containers after a failed deployment or after moving stacks in and out of `COMPOSE_DIR`. diff --git a/docs/mint.json b/docs/mint.json index ed6d8365..e986e350 100644 --- a/docs/mint.json +++ b/docs/mint.json @@ -24,8 +24,13 @@ "group": "Features", "pages": [ "features/overview", + "features/dashboard", "features/stack-management", "features/editor", + "features/resources", + "features/app-store", + "features/global-observability", + "features/host-console", "features/multi-node", "features/alerts-notifications" ]
